How to fill out local scholarships:

01
Start by researching local scholarships in your area. Look for organizations, businesses, or foundations that offer scholarships specifically for students in your city or community.
02
Review the eligibility criteria for each scholarship. Make sure you meet all the requirements before applying.
03
Gather all the necessary documents and information needed to complete the application. This may include your academ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, personal statement, and any additional requirements specified by the scholarship provider.
04
Carefully read and understand the application instructions. Ensure that you provide all the requested information accurately and within the given deadline.
05
Write a compelling personal statement. Express your goals, aspirations, and how the scholarship would benefit you. Tailor your statement to the specific scholarship you are applying for.
06
Request letters of recommendation from teachers, mentors, or community leaders who can speak to your character, achievements, and potential. Be sure to provide them with all the necessary information and deadline for submission.
07
Proofread your application to eliminate any errors or mistakes. Pay attention to grammar, spelling, and overall clarity.
08
Submit your application before the deadline. Keep track of the submission method (online, mail, or hand-delivery) and ensure that you have followed all instructions correctly.
09
Follow up with the scholarship provider to confirm that your application has been received and to inquire about the selection timeline.
10
If you are awarded a local scholarship, express your gratitude by sending a thank-you note or email to the scholarship provider.

Who needs local scholarships:

01
High school students planning to attend college or university in their local area can benefit from local scholarships. These scholarships often support students who demonstrate academic excellence, financial need, or community involvement.
02
College students who are already enrolled in a local institution may also be eligible for local scholarships. These scholarships can help offset tuition costs, provide support for specific educational programs, or encourage students to stay in the local community.
03
Non-traditional students, such as adults returning to school or individuals pursuing vocational or technical training, may find local scholarships specifically tailored to their needs. These scholarships can provide financial assistance and encourage continued education within the local community.
